24 /* <DESC>
25  * Shows HTTPS usage with client certs and optional ssl engine use.
26  * </DESC>
27  */
28 #include <stdio.h>
29 
30 #include <curl/curl.h>
31 
32 /* some requirements for this to work:
33    1.   set pCertFile to the file with the client certificate
34    2.   if the key is passphrase protected, set pPassphrase to the
35         passphrase you use
36    3.   if you are using a crypto engine:
37    3.1. set a #define USE_ENGINE
38    3.2. set pEngine to the name of the crypto engine you use
39    3.3. set pKeyName to the key identifier you want to use
40    4.   if you do not use a crypto engine:
41    4.1. set pKeyName to the filename of your client key
42    4.2. if the format of the key file is DER, set pKeyType to "DER"
43 
44    !! verify of the server certificate is not implemented here !!
45 
46    **** This example only works with libcurl 7.9.3 and later! ****
47 
48 */
49 
main(void)50 int main(void)
51 {
52   CURL *curl;
53   CURLcode res;
54   FILE *headerfile;
55   const char *pPassphrase = NULL;
56 
57   static const char *pCertFile = "testcert.pem";
58   static const char *pCACertFile = "cacert.pem";
59   static const char *pHeaderFile = "dumpit";
60 
61   const char *pKeyName;
62   const char *pKeyType;
63 
64   const char *pEngine;
65 
66 #ifdef USE_ENGINE
67   pKeyName  = "rsa_test";
68   pKeyType  = "ENG";
69   pEngine   = "chil";            /* for nChiper HSM... */
70 #else
71   pKeyName  = "testkey.pem";
72   pKeyType  = "PEM";
73   pEngine   = NULL;
74 #endif
75 
76   headerfile = fopen(pHeaderFile, "wb");
77 
78   curl_global_init(CURL_GLOBAL_DEFAULT);
79 
80   curl = curl_easy_init();
81   if(curl) {
82     /* what call to write: */
83     curl_easy_setopt(curl, CURLOPT_URL, "HTTPS://your.favourite.ssl.site");
84     curl_easy_setopt(curl, CURLOPT_HEADERDATA, headerfile);
85 
86     do { /* dummy loop, just to break out from */
87       if(pEngine) {
88         /* use crypto engine */
89         if(curl_easy_setopt(curl, CURLOPT_SSLENGINE, pEngine) != CURLE_OK) {
90           /* load the crypto engine */
91           fprintf(stderr, "cannot set crypto engine\n");
92           break;
93         }
94         if(curl_easy_setopt(curl, CURLOPT_SSLENGINE_DEFAULT, 1L) != CURLE_OK) {
95           /* set the crypto engine as default */
96           /* only needed for the first time you load
97              an engine in a curl object... */
98           fprintf(stderr, "cannot set crypto engine as default\n");
99           break;
100         }
101       }
102       /* cert is stored PEM coded in file... */
103       /* since PEM is default, we needn't set it for PEM */
104       curl_easy_setopt(curl, CURLOPT_SSLCERTTYPE, "PEM");
105 
106       /* set the cert for client authentication */
107       curl_easy_setopt(curl, CURLOPT_SSLCERT, pCertFile);
108 
109       /* sorry, for engine we must set the passphrase
110          (if the key has one...) */
111       if(pPassphrase)
112         curl_easy_setopt(curl, CURLOPT_KEYPASSWD, pPassphrase);
113 
114       /* if we use a key stored in a crypto engine,
115          we must set the key type to "ENG" */
116       curl_easy_setopt(curl, CURLOPT_SSLKEYTYPE, pKeyType);
117 
118       /* set the private key (file or ID in engine) */
119       curl_easy_setopt(curl, CURLOPT_SSLKEY, pKeyName);
120 
121       /* set the file with the certs validating the server */
122       curl_easy_setopt(curl, CURLOPT_CAINFO, pCACertFile);
123 
124       /* disconnect if we cannot validate server's cert */
125       curl_easy_setopt(curl, CURLOPT_SSL_VERIFYPEER, 1L);
126 
127       /* Perform the request, res gets the return code */
128       res = curl_easy_perform(curl);
129       /* Check for errors */
130       if(res != CURLE_OK)
131         fprintf(stderr, "curl_easy_perform() failed: %s\n",
132                 curl_easy_strerror(res));
133 
134       /* we are done... */
135     } while(0);
136     /* always cleanup */
137     curl_easy_cleanup(curl);
138   }
139 
140   curl_global_cleanup();
141 
142   return 0;
143 }
